智能语音机器人的语音模型压缩技术
智能语音机器人作为一种新兴的人工智能技术,已经广泛应用于各种场景,如智能家居、客服、教育等。然而,随着语音模型复杂度的增加,模型的存储和计算成本也随之上升。为了解决这一问题,智能语音机器人的语音模型压缩技术应运而生。本文将介绍语音模型压缩技术的原理、方法及其在智能语音机器人中的应用。
一、语音模型压缩技术的背景
- 语音模型的复杂性
近年来,深度学习在语音识别领域取得了显著的成果。基于深度学习的语音模型通常包含大量的神经元和参数,模型复杂度高。这导致了以下问题:
(1)存储成本高:模型文件体积庞大,占用大量存储空间。
(2)计算资源消耗大:模型在推理过程中需要大量的计算资源,导致设备运行缓慢。
(3)实时性差:模型推理速度慢,难以满足实时性要求。
- 语音模型压缩技术的必要性
为了解决上述问题,研究人员提出了语音模型压缩技术。该技术旨在降低语音模型的复杂度,提高模型的存储和计算效率,从而实现智能语音机器人在各种场景下的广泛应用。
二、语音模型压缩技术的原理
语音模型压缩技术主要包括以下两种方法:
- 线性量化
线性量化是将连续的数值转换为有限个离散值的过程。在语音模型中,将连续的浮点数参数转换为有限个整数参数,降低模型的复杂度。线性量化方法简单,但压缩效果有限。
- 非线性量化
非线性量化是通过对模型参数进行非线性变换,将参数压缩到较低维度。常见的非线性量化方法包括:
(1)稀疏化:将模型参数转换为稀疏表示,只保留重要的参数,丢弃冗余参数。
(2)低秩分解:将模型参数分解为低秩矩阵,降低模型的复杂度。
(3)变换域压缩:将模型参数转换到变换域(如傅里叶变换域、小波变换域),对变换系数进行量化,降低模型的复杂度。
三、语音模型压缩技术在智能语音机器人中的应用
- 智能家居
在智能家居领域,语音模型压缩技术可以应用于语音助手、语音控制等场景。通过压缩语音模型,降低模型的存储和计算成本,提高设备的运行效率。
- 客服
在客服领域,语音模型压缩技术可以应用于语音识别、语音合成等场景。通过压缩语音模型,降低客服中心的服务成本,提高服务效率。
- 教育
在教育领域,语音模型压缩技术可以应用于语音识别、语音合成等场景。通过压缩语音模型,降低教育设备的成本,提高教育资源的普及率。
- 语音识别
在语音识别领域,语音模型压缩技术可以提高模型在移动设备上的识别准确率。通过压缩语音模型,降低模型的存储和计算成本,提高设备的运行速度。
- 语音合成
在语音合成领域,语音模型压缩技术可以提高合成语音的自然度。通过压缩语音模型,降低模型的存储和计算成本,提高设备的运行速度。
四、总结
语音模型压缩技术是智能语音机器人领域的一项重要技术。通过降低语音模型的复杂度,提高模型的存储和计算效率,语音模型压缩技术为智能语音机器人在各个领域的应用提供了有力支持。随着语音模型压缩技术的不断发展,智能语音机器人将在未来发挥更加重要的作用。
猜你喜欢:AI问答助手